Understanding Car Service Costs and Estimates
Understanding how repair shops price their work is essential for making educated service decisions. Car service centers typically charge flat-rate pricing based on industry labor guides. Common services range from $35-$90 for an oil change to $150-$400 for brake service to $500-$1,200 for timing belt replacement. Most reputable shops provide free estimates before performing any work.
Before approving any car service, get the quote in writing that specifies any diagnostic or shop fees. Many car service centers offer financing options for major repairs. Ask about warranty coverage on parts and labor to understand what protection comes with your service.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does the check engine light mean?
The check engine light indicates your vehicle’s onboard computer has detected a problem requiring attention. It could be a loose gas cap. A flashing light indicates an active misfire requiring immediate attention. Have it checked by a qualified technician promptly to prevent increased emissions.
How long do brakes last?
Brake pad lifespan depends on driving habits and style: typically 25,000-65,000 miles for standard pads. Warning signs include squealing or grinding noises. Have brakes inspected annually as part of routine service.
What maintenance does my car need at 100,000 miles?
At 100,000 miles, most vehicles need transmission fluid exchange. This is a critical ownership milestone where a thorough inspection can add productive years to your vehicle. A comprehensive 100K milestone service typically costs $500-$1,500 but can prevent thousands in emergency repair costs.
Is it safe to drive with a check engine light on?
A solid orange/amber light generally means you can drive safely to your service center, but don’t ignore it for weeks. A blinking indicator means pull over and call for assistance and have the vehicle professionally diagnosed before driving further.

Tips for Your Car Service Visit
To make the most of your visit to a car service center in Knoxville TN, write down any symptoms including unusual sounds, smells, warning lights, and when the problem occurs. Having your vehicle’s maintenance history available helps the technician assess your situation more accurately and avoid recommending service that was recently completed.
Before work begins, ask for a written estimate covering parts, labor, and any diagnostic fees. Clarify whether the quote is firm or subject to change. Ask about warranty coverage on both parts and labor, and request that the shop call you before performing any additional work beyond the original estimate.
